it will be safer to replace loom


most alarms have just a few points in the wiring loom where they connect


they will have power obviously. and atleast two immobilisation circuits which will be four wires as it breaks a circuit then goes through the alarm then back to the loom further along and makes the circuit again you you get that :?

just trace the wires back from the alarm, you'll find four of the wires go back to wires that are only two colours. join the same colour wires together & just cut the rest. sorted.

Posted

that all depends on how deep tey went into the loom if they've just tapped into it then its a diddle but if they done it properly then its not so much of a diddle
